Las Vegas Strip
📍 Location: In front of Bellagio Hotel (Center Strip)
💵 Cost: 100% FREE
⏳ Show length: ~5 minutes
🎯 Best for: First-time visitors, couples, families, photographers
🌊 What the Bellagio Fountains Really Are
The Bellagio Fountains are the most famous free attraction in Las Vegas. The show features:
- Over 1,200 water jets
- Water shooting up to 460 feet
- Choreographed to music (classical, pop, opera, rock)
- Lights + sound synchronized perfectly
Every show is different, depending on the song.
⏰ Show Times (Updated & Typical)
🕒 Daytime
- Every 30 minutes
- Usually from 3:00 PM – 7:00 PM
🌙 Evening / Night
- Every 15 minutes
- Usually from 7:00 PM – 12:00 AM
⚠️ Times may vary due to weather or maintenance.
👀 Best Places to Watch (Very Important)
⭐ BEST VIEWING SPOTS
- Bellagio sidewalk (center section) – closest & loudest
- Across the street near Paris Las Vegas – full wide view
- Bellagio lakeside railing – immersive experience
⚠️ OK BUT LESS IDEAL
- Too far north or south of the lake
- Behind trees or lamp posts
💡 Arrive 10–15 minutes early at night for prime spots.

Fountain Show Schedule
- Monday–Friday:
- Every 30 minutes: 3:00 PM to 7:00 PM
- Every 15 minutes: 7:00 PM to midnight
- Saturday–Sunday:
- Every 30 minutes: 12:00 PM to 7:00 PM
- Every 15 minutes: 7:00 PM to midnight

Top Restaurants to Visit at or Near Bellagio Fountains, Las Vegas
| Restaurant | Location | Type of Food | Highlights | Approx. Cost (Per Person)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Picasso | Inside Bellagio Hotel | French and Spanish | Michelin-starred; offers terrace seating with fountain views. | $150–$250 |
| Prime Steakhouse | Inside Bellagio Hotel | Steakhouse | Elegant dining with lakeside views of the Bellagio Fountains. | $100–$200 |
| Spago by Wolfgang Puck | Inside Bellagio Hotel | Californian | Overlooks the fountains with seasonal, farm-to-table cuisine. | $80–$150 |
| Mon Ami Gabi | Paris Las Vegas (across the street) | French Bistro | Charming ambiance with patio seating offering clear fountain views. | $50–$80 |
| Lago by Julian Serrano | Inside Bellagio Hotel | Italian Tapas | Offers small plates and cocktails with a front-row view of the fountains. | $60–$120 |
| Eiffel Tower Restaurant | Paris Las Vegas | French Fine Dining | Located in the Eiffel Tower replica, offering panoramic views of the fountains. | $125–$250 |
| The Mayfair Supper Club | Inside Bellagio Hotel | Modern American | Combines fine dining with live entertainment and fountain views. | $150–$300 |
| Catch | ARIA Resort & Casino | Seafood | Trendy spot with a mix of seafood and vegetarian dishes near the fountains. | $80–$150 |
| Le Cirque | Inside Bellagio Hotel | French Cuisine | Known for its vibrant decor and impeccable service; close to fountains. | $150–$250 |
| Hexx Kitchen + Bar | Paris Las Vegas (across the street) | American | Offers casual dining with outdoor seating and great fountain views. | $30–$60 |
Tips for Dining Near Bellagio Fountains
- Make Reservations: Restaurants with fountain views are in high demand, especially during dinner hours.
- Dine During Shows: Plan your meal to coincide with fountain performances for a magical experience.
- Dress Code: Fine dining restaurants like Le Cirque and Eiffel Tower Restaurant may have formal or semi-formal dress codes.
Nearest Bus Stops, Metro Stations, and Railway Stations to Bellagio Fountains, Las Vegas
| Transport Type | Name/Stop | Location | Key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bus Stop | Las Vegas Blvd @ Bellagio | Directly in front of the Bellagio Hotel. | Serves multiple RTC (Regional Transportation Commission) bus routes, including The Deuce. |
| Bus Stop | Las Vegas Blvd @ Paris Las Vegas | Across the street from the Bellagio. | Convenient for accessing the Paris Hotel, Eiffel Tower, and Bellagio Fountains. |
| Metro Station | Las Vegas Monorail – Bally’s/Paris Station | Behind Bally’s Hotel, a short walk to Bellagio. | Provides quick access to mid-Strip locations, including the Bellagio. |
| Metro Station | Las Vegas Monorail – Flamingo/Caesars Palace Station | Near Flamingo and Caesars Palace hotels, close to Bellagio. | Ideal for accessing the Bellagio and other nearby attractions on the Strip. |
| Railway Station | Amtrak Thruway Bus at Greyhound Station | Downtown Las Vegas, about 15–20 minutes from Bellagio. | Connects to Amtrak’s intercity services and regional bus routes. |
Tips for Using Public Transportation
- The Deuce Bus: This double-decker bus runs 24/7 along the Strip, providing affordable and frequent access to Bellagio.
- Las Vegas Monorail: Purchase a day pass for unlimited rides if you plan to explore multiple attractions along the Strip.
- Walkability: The Bellagio is centrally located, making it easy to access nearby attractions on foot.
